1. Set motivational goals.

When you set personal goals, it’s always essential to ensure that they motivate you. These goals need to be important to you, and there should be enough value to encourage you to achieve them. It’s vital to set motivational goals because if you are not excited or challenged by your targets’ outcomes, or they’re irrelevant to any bigger picture, you’ll likely not put in the work required to make them happen. Therefore, always set goals related to life’s highest priorities since these targets have a sense of urgency and provide enough motivation for you to succeed.

Financial security is a typical example of a motivational goal worth setting to give you enough incentive for success. 2. Set measurable goals.

Vague goal setting is detrimental to the whole idea of setting and achieving targets, so you should always set measurable and clear goals. For example, it isn’t enough to set targets like “reducing expenses” or “getting more customers” to drive company success. If your goals are defined like this, there would be no real way to know when you’re successful. Therefore, include precise dates, time frames, amounts, and other quantifiable standards against which you can measure your goals.

3. Always write down your goals.

Writing down your targets makes them tangible and real, so always endeavor to write them down for the best results. When your targets are written down, it’s more difficult to forget about them. When writing down your goals, always structure your objective statements positively using words like “will” instead of “might” or “would like to”. Also, post these goals around visible places to continually remind yourself of the targets that lie ahead of you. Areas like your desk, bathroom mirror, refrigerator, and computer monitor are excellent areas to post your goals, so keep this in mind.
